Strategic Layout and Room Selection

The journey begins with selecting the right room, which is typically the hardest foundation to alter. Ideally, you want a space that is rectangular, avoiding multi-faceted nooks that create acoustic nightmares. The goal is to position the seating row roughly centered between the side walls to minimize early reflections that muddy dialogue. Consider the location of doors and windows; a room with fewer openings allows for better light control and sound isolation, ensuring that your viewing experience remains immersive regardless of the time of day.
Optimizing the Sweet Spot

In small home theater designs, the "sweet spot"—the ideal seating position for optimal viewing angles—is critical. You generally want a field of view between 30 and 45 degrees horizontally. To calculate this, measure the width of your screen and ensure the viewing distance is approximately 1 to 1.5 times the screen width. This proximity is one of the key advantages of small setups, as it allows for a comfortable seating arrangement without the need for a cavernous room, bringing you closer to the action and enhancing the sense of presence.
Acoustic Treatment Fundamentals

Sound management is non-negotiable in compact spaces, where reflections can quickly turn a decent setup into a muddy mess. Rather than aiming for total soundproofing, focus on absorption to control reverberation time. Placing thick absorption panels on the first reflection points—where sound bounces off the side walls toward the listening position—is essential. Bass trapping in the corners helps mitigate the boominess that small rooms frequently suffer from, resulting in tighter, clearer low-end response.
Practical Solutions for Tight Spaces
- Install broadband absorption panels on the walls behind the seating area to dampen echoes.
- Use thick rugs and cushions to absorb airborne sound and reduce floor reflections.
- Mount speakers tight to the walls or use stands to decouple them from boundary surfaces.
- Consider a floating floor on heavy underlayment to isolate structure-borne noise.

Visual Ergonomics and Screen Placement
The visual component of small home theater designs requires precision to avoid neck strain and eye fatigue. The center of the screen should be at eye level when seated, which often means mounting the screen lower than you might expect. For flat screens, a gap of roughly 4 to 5 inches from the top of the screen to the viewer’s eye line is a good starting point. If you are using a projector, short-throw lenses are indispensable, as they allow you to achieve a large image without casting the projector’s shadow on the screen or requiring a lengthy throw distance.
Lighting and Ambiance Control

Lighting is the silent conductor of the cinematic experience. In small rooms, you have the luxury of being able to control the entire environment with relative ease. Installing dimmable LED strips behind the TV or screen creates bias lighting, which reduces eye strain by illuminating the wall behind the display. Blackout curtains are a must to prevent exterior light bleed, while smart bulbs allow you to program "cinema modes" that gradually dim the lights to prepare your eyes for the movie.
Furniture and Spatial Efficiency
















Furniture selection in a small home theater should prioritize form and function equally. Low-profile seats or sleek sectional sofas ensure that the room does not feel crowded while maintaining comfort for long viewing sessions. Avoid tall bookcases or floor lamps that can block the line of sight; instead, opt for wall-mounted shelves and ceiling-mounted fixtures. The color palette should lean toward dark, non-reflective hues to absorb light and create a cocoon-like atmosphere that makes the bright screen the focal point.
Technology Integration and Cable Management
A small home theater is only as good as its connectivity. Modern AV receivers with HDMI 2.1 support allow you to future-proof your setup, handling 4K signals and high-bandwidth audio formats like Dolby Atmos. Wireless solutions such as in-ear headphones or wireless rear speakers can eliminate the visual clutter of wires, but wired connections generally offer lower latency and higher reliability for critical audio-video sync. Sophisticated cable management—using conduits, raceways, and in-wall wiring—is not just aesthetic; it reduces clutter that can make a small room feel even smaller.
